CARRINGTON (NewsDakota)- The Carrington girls basketball team took their only region loss in December when they traveled to Hillsboro/Central Valley.  Since, the Cards had won nine straight entering the rematch with the Burros.

And they made sure there was no repeat performance.

Aniston Hoornaert and Marah Johnson combined for 37 points as the Cardinals rolled to their tenth straight victory, 44-23, on Saturday inside the East Gymnasium.

The first quarter was a complete rock fight, with both teams making only one field goal as Carrington (12-3, 9-1) led 8-5.  In the second, Hoornaert scored seven of her twenty points and the Cards led 17-13 at the half.

But in the second half, the Cards took over behind a huge half from Johnson, who scored thirteen of her seventeen after the break as Carrington led by as many as 26.  Rayna Betner scored eight of her team high ten points in the fourth quarter for the Burros (9-8, 4-6).
